A gun-wielding attacker entered a house and opened fire indiscriminately in northwestern Pakistan’s Khyber Pakhtunkhwa province on Wednesday. During this, nine members of the same family died. The incident took place in Batkhela tehsil of Malakand district, police said. The assailant shot dead nine members of a family, including three women and six men.
After getting the information, the local levies force reached the spot and shifted the bodies to Batkhela Hospital for postmortem. According to the police, a marriage dispute was the reason behind the brutal murder and investigation has been launched. Caretaker Chief Minister Muhammad Azam Khan has directed the police to intensify efforts to arrest the accused. He told that the accused would be brought to book. Justice will be given to the victim’s family.
